dsPIC33EPXXGS50X FAMILY
3.0
CPU
The dsPIC33EPXXGS50X family CPU has a 16-bit
(data) modified Harvard architecture with an enhanced
instruction set, including significant support for Digital
Signal Processing (DSP). The CPU has a 24-bit
instruction word with a variable length opcode field.
The Program Counter (PC) is 23 bits wide and
addresses up to 4M x 24 bits of user program memory
space.
An instruction prefetch mechanism helps maintain
throughput and provides predictable execution. Most
instructions execute in a single-cycle effective execu-
tion rate, with the exception of instructions that change
the program flow, the double-word move (MOV.D)
instruction, PSV accesses and the table instructions.
Overhead-free program loop constructs are supported
using the DO and REPEAT instructions, both of which
are interruptible at any point.
3.1
Registers
The dsPIC33EPXXGS50X devices have sixteen, 16-bit
Working registers in the programmer’s model. Each of the
Working registers can act as a data, address or address
offset register. The 16th Working register (W15) operates
as a Software Stack Pointer for interrupts and calls.
In addition, the dsPIC33EPXXGS50X devices include
two Alternate Working register sets which consist of W0
through W14. The Alternate registers can be made per-
sistent to help reduce the saving and restoring of register
content during Interrupt Service Routines (ISRs). The
Alternate Working registers can be assigned to a specific
Interrupt Priority Level (IPL1 through IPL6) by configuring
the CTXTx<2:0> bits in the FALTREG Configuration
register. The Alternate Working registers can also be
accessed manually by using the CTXTSWP instruction.
The CCTXI<2:0> and MCTXI<2:0> bits in the CTXTSTAT
register can be used to identify the current and most
recent, manually selected Working register sets.
3.2
Instruction Set
The instruction set for dsPIC33EPXXGS50X devices
has two classes of instructions: the MCU class of
instructions and the DSP class of instructions. These
two instruction classes are seamlessly integrated into the
architecture and execute from a single execution unit.
The instruction set includes many addressing modes and
was designed for optimum C compiler efficiency.
3.3
Data Space Addressing
The base Data Space can be addressed as up to
4K words or 8 Kbytes, and is split into two blocks,
referred to as X and Y data memory. Each memory block
has its own independent Address Generation Unit
(AGU). The MCU class of instructions operates solely
through the X memory AGU, which accesses the entire
memory map as one linear Data Space. Certain DSP
instructions operate through the X and Y AGUs to sup-
port dual operand reads, which splits the data address
space into two parts. The X and Y Data Space boundary
is device-specific.
The upper 32 Kbytes of the Data Space memory map
can optionally be mapped into Program Space (PS) at
any 16K program word boundary. The program-to-Data
Space mapping feature, known as Program Space
Visibility (PSV), lets any instruction access Program
Space as if it were Data Space. Refer to “Data
Memory”
(DS70595) in the “dsPIC33/PIC24 Family
Reference Manual”
for more details on PSV and table
accesses.
On dsPIC33EPXXGS50X devices, overhead-free
circular buffers (Modulo Addressing) are supported in
both X and Y address spaces. The Modulo Addressing
removes the software boundary checking overhead for
DSP algorithms. The X AGU Circular Addressing can
be used with any of the MCU class of instructions. The
X AGU also supports Bit-Reversed Addressing to
greatly simplify input or output data re-ordering for
radix-2 FFT algorithms.
3.4
Addressing Modes
The CPU supports these addressing modes:
• Inherent (no operand)
• Relative
•Literal
• Memory Direct
• Register Direct
• Register Indirect
Each instruction is associated with a predefined
addressing mode group, depending upon its functional
requirements. As many as six addressing modes are
supported for each instruction.
